Explore your local surroundings, where just a short walk away you will find the welcoming Wisemans Bridge Inn, which serves tasty local ales and home-cooked meals, the perfect excuse for having a night off from the kitchen! For a day at the beach, the glorious sands of Coppet Hall Beach are easily accessible, here you can bathe, paddle the shores or take to the waters on a kayak or paddleboard. For a wider selection of amenities, head over to Saundersfoot, where you will be kept busy with an excellent selection of shops, pubs and restaurants, whilst those who enjoy angling can take advantage of the brilliant fishing opportunities or boat trips on offer. Be sure to spend a day at the village’s picturesque Blue Flag beach or if you’re looking to soak up the sights, why not embark on a hike of the 186-mile Pembrokeshire Coast Path within easy access from The Dingle’s driveway on foot. A great place to enjoy picturesque coastal walks with Wiseman’s Bridge beach within 10 minutes walk and Amroth beach 20 minutes walk away from The Dingle. Or if you prefer to cycle head to Saundersfoot through the tunnel from Wisemans which once carried coal from local mines. This old railway line heads up to the historic ruins of Stepaside Iron Works and is great for children or wheelchairs. Just a little further you will find the historic town of Tenby, well-known for it’s 13th-century town walls, the remains of Tenby Castle which overlook the village and award-winning beach, as well as its ample watersporting and adventure opportunities, including cliff jumping, cave swimming and rock climbing!
